Stone Mountain Park
1000 Robert E Lee Blvd, Stone Mountain, GA 30083, USA
(800) 401-2407
Stone Mountain is a pluton, a type of igneous intrusion. Primarily composed of quartz monzonite, the dome of Stone Mountain was formed during the formation of the Blue Ridge Mountains around 300–350 million years ago (during the Carboniferous period), part of the Appalachian Mountains.
